python3菜鸟代码大全

删除Python代码错误是编程过程中非常常见的操作。在编写代码时,可能会出现语法错误、逻辑错误或运行时错误。以下是一些解决错误的通用步骤和一些相关知识。

1. 语法错误(Syntax Errors):

- 语法错误是编写代码时最常见的错误之一。这些错误通常是由拼写错误、缺少冒号、缺少引号或缺少缩进等引起的。

- 要解决语法错误,可以仔细检查代码并根据错误信息进行修复。Python会显示报错的行号和具体错误信息,以便更容易定位和修复错误。

2. 逻辑错误(Logic Errors):

- 逻辑错误是代码执行过程中的错误。这些错误可能是因为算法逻辑的问题,或者是变量赋值、判断条件不正确等引起的。

- 要解决逻辑错误,可以使用调试工具来定位错误发生的位置,并进行变量的监控和跟踪。还可以使用断言语句来验证代码的正确性。

3. 运行时错误(Runtime Errors):

- 运行时错误通常是在代码执行期间引发的错误,例如除以零、索引超出范围、变量类型错误等。

- 要解决运行时错误,可以使用异常处理机制来捕获和处理异常。使用try-except语句可以调用相关代码,并处理异常情况以避免程序崩溃。

4. 调试工具(Debugging Tools):

- Python提供了一些强大的调试工具,帮助开发者找出并解决错误。其中包括pdb(Python Debugger),它可以用于逐行调试Python代码。

- 使用pdb工具,可以在代码中插入调试断点,并一步一步地执行代码。通过查看变量的值和执行路径,可以更好地理解代码的执行过程。

5. 日志记录(Logging):

- 在开发过程中,记录日志可以帮助我们更好地追踪代码的执行过程。Python内置了logging模块,可以以不同的级别记录不同的日志消息。

- 在关键的代码段中插入日志语句,并根据需要设置日志级别,可以帮助我们了解代码的执行流程和变量的值。

在解决错误的时候,还有一些其他的常用技巧:

- 回顾错误消息:仔细阅读错误消息,并尝试理解其中的提示和信息。

- 缩小问题范围:在代码中分步执行,观察错误发生的位置,以帮助定位问题。

- 使用打印语句:在关键位置插入打印语句,输出变量的值或执行路径,以了解代码在执行时的状态。

- 参考官方文档:Python官方文档提供了丰富的信息和示例,可以帮助我们了解函数、方法和模块的用法。

总之,解决Python代码错误需要耐心、细心和对编程的深入理解。通过熟悉常见错误类型、有效地使用调试工具和日志记录技术,以及勤于参考官方文档,我们可以更高效地解决错误并改进自己的编程技能。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/

点赞(5)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部